How an automatic mileage log from GPS works
An automatic mileage log from GPS rests on a small unit in the vehicle that continuously transmits the position. From that data the application assembles individual journeys with the route, time, distance and odometer reading.
Your role narrows to checking and classifying the type of journey. Estimating distances and writing entries into a paper notebook in the evening both disappear.

Classifying journeys as Business, Private or Unclassified
You simply mark each journey as Business, Private or Unclassified. For business journeys you add the purpose; private ones only need marking and counting into the distance.
The Unclassified category acts as a safety net – you see immediately which journeys are still waiting to be categorised, so no record escapes without the correct type.

Audit trail and credibility
If you edit a record, the change stays in the audit trail – it is clear who edited the journey and when. That gives the records greater credibility than paper, which can be rewritten without trace.
